WebSep 23, 2008 · A note which forms this interval with any of the chord notes is considered an "avoid note". So let's take your Em7 chord E, G, B, D. The avoid notes are F, Ab, C, Eb. Now, "avoid" doesn't actually mean don't play. The general rules are - Don't hold an avoid note against the chord.
